Object description
Memoir (228pp ts), written in the 1980s, covering his early years in Poland (1916 - 1936), training with the Polish Air Force and posting to 162 Squadron (Third Fighter Wing, Sixth Air Force Regiment) at Lwow in June 1939, their mobilisation and move to Widzew to support the Lodz Army in September 1939, his escape to Rumania and then France during September - October 1939, evacuation to the United Kingdom in June 1940 and training at the Polish Air Force base at Blackpool before serving with 307 Squadron at RAF Kirton-in-Lindsey (September - October 1940), flying Hurricanes with 303 Squadron at RAF Leconfield (October 1940 - January 1941) and Spitfires with 315 Squadron at RAF Acklington, RAF Speke, RAF Woodvale and RAF Northolt (January 1941 - February 1943), command of 308 Squadron and then of 317 Squadron at RAF Martlesham Heath, RAF Heston, RAF Fairlop and RAF Perranporth (May 1943 - January 1944) subsequent service as Liaison Officer with HQ 11 Group, Uxbridge and 9 Group, Preston (January - May 1944), attending the Polish Air Force Staff College at Weston-super-Mare (May - November 1944), acting as Polish Liaison Officer with HQ 84 Group, 2nd TAF, in s'Hertogenbosch, Holland, and Celle, Germany (November 1944 - November 1945), with No 3 Polish Personnel Holding Unit, RAF Newton, near Nottingham (November 1945 - December 1946) and the Polish Resettlement Corps at Framlingham, Suffolk (December 1946 - December 1948) before rejoining the RAF in 1951 and serving as a catering officer until 1958; also included is a list (9pp) of graduates of the Polish Air Force College, Deblin, 1936 - 1939.
